SG Americas Securities LLC trimmed its position in shares of ProShares S&P Kensho Cleantech ETF (NYSEARCA:CTEX – Free Report) by 31.2%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 19,054 shares of the company’s stock after selling 8,648 shares during the quarter. SG Americas Securities LLC owned approximately 0.13% of ProShares S&P Kensho Cleantech ETF worth $409,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.
ProShares S&P Kensho Cleantech ETF Trading Down 1.3 %
ProShares S&P Kensho Cleantech ETF stock opened at $21.37 on Monday.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.21 million, a P/E ratio of 11.71 and a beta of 1.92.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$22.12 and a 200 day moving average price of $21.88. ProShares S&P Kensho Cleantech ETF has a 52 week low of $19.80 and a 52 week high of $25.67.
